Java Spark-dataset.persist():如何检查数据集是否持久化?
如何检查数据集是否已持久化Java Spark-dataset.persist():如何检查数据集是否持久化?,java,apache-spark,Java,Apache Spark,如何检查数据集是否已持久化 dataset.persist(); 1若要查看是否缓存,请尝试使用sparkSession.catalog.isCached(“viewName”)2若要判断磁盘中是否缓存了数据,请在Spark Web UI的存储选项卡中查看。您还可以检查数据集.queryExecution。具有的缓存数据集具有InMemoryRelation和InMemoryTableScan@Philantrover谢谢,但未完全涵盖。如果我使用StorageLevel.MEMORY和DIS
dataset.persist();
1若要查看是否缓存,请尝试使用sparkSession.catalog.isCached(“viewName”)
2若要判断磁盘中是否缓存了数据,请在Spark Web UI的存储选项卡中查看。您还可以检查
数据集.queryExecution
。具有的缓存数据集具有InMemoryRelation
和InMemoryTableScan
@Philantrover谢谢,但未完全涵盖。如果我使用StorageLevel.MEMORY和DISK\u SER()呢?